What is a Soap Dish for Freestanding Tub?
A soap dish for a freestanding tub is a small, often decorative, tray or container that is designed to hold soap, shampoo, and other bath products. It can be attached to the side of the tub or placed on a nearby surface, allowing for easy access to your favorite products while you soak.
Why Use a Soap Dish for Freestanding Tub?
Using a soap dish for a freestanding tub has several benefits. First, it keeps your bath products in one convenient location, so you don’t have to fumble around for them while you’re trying to relax. Second, it can help prevent your products from getting wet and becoming slippery, which can be dangerous when you’re in the tub. Finally, a soap dish can add a stylish touch to your bathroom decor.

Top 10 Tips and Ideas on Soap Dish for Freestanding Tub
- Choose a soap dish that is easy to clean and maintain, so you can keep it looking fresh and new.
- Consider a soap dish with drainage holes or a removable tray, to prevent water from pooling and causing mold or mildew.
- Look for soap dishes with suction cups or adhesive backing, which can be easily removed or repositioned as needed.
- Opt for a soap dish with a non-slip bottom, to prevent it from sliding around on the surface of your tub.
- Choose a soap dish with a lid, to keep your products protected from water and debris.
- Consider using a soap dish with multiple compartments, to keep your different bath products organized and easy to access.
- Look for soap dishes made from durable materials, such as stainless steel or plastic, which can withstand exposure to water and humidity.
- Choose a soap dish with a decorative design or pattern, to add a touch of style to your bathroom decor.
- Consider purchasing a matching set of soap dishes and other bath accessories, to create a cohesive look in your bathroom.
- Experiment with different soap dish placements and configurations, to find the setup that works best for your needs and preferences.

Q: How do I clean and maintain a soap dish for a freestanding tub?
A: To clean a soap dish for a freestanding tub, simply wipe it down with a damp cloth or sponge. For tougher stains or buildup, you can use a mild soap and warm water solution. Be sure to dry the dish thoroughly after cleaning, and remove any excess water from the tray or draining holes to prevent mold or mildew.
